How to Choose Durable Mobility Scooters
Mobility scooters are an excellent option to travel easily and comfortably. It can even help you take on outdoor adventures. However, there are some aspects to consider when picking a model.
If you intend to use your scooter on rough or steep terrain, consider looking at the highest incline rating and motor power. Some scooters are specifically designed to handle slopes and hills.
Frame made of sturdy material
A solid frame for a mobility scooter is essential. This will allow you to navigate uneven surfaces, inclines and ensure you are comfortable. It will also allow you to carry more weight without compromising stability or safety. The frame you choose will directly impact the ability of your self-balancing mobility scooters scooter to fulfill its intended function. The frame of the scooter must be able to support your weight comfortably, and it should be constructed in a way that makes it easy to maneuver through tight spaces.
The tiller is another important feature to consider. The tiller is the control box that sits on the top of your handlebars. It's used to control the scooter. If you are tall, it is essential to choose a tiller with adjustable height. If not, it may be a risk to smack your knees when sitting. The tiller should also have a variety of controls including digital readouts, color-coding indicators, odometers, and speed control settings.
Sturdy mobility scooters are equipped with powerful motors and drive systems that offer high torque capabilities. These features let them be used by users with a wide range of mobility requirements and navigate difficult terrains such as grassy fields or gravel pathways. They also come with long-range batteries, which allow them to travel longer distances before needing recharge.

The tires on a mobility scooter play a significant role in its performance and safety. They can make the difference between a pleasant ride and a bumpy, bumpy one. The selection of tires is based on the terrain you prefer as well as your personal preferences and the weight of the scooter. Both solid and air tires are obtainable for mobility scooters, and each type has its own benefits.
For instance air tires provide a cushioned ride and excellent stability on smooth surfaces. However, they are susceptible to punctures and should not be used near broken glass or other sharp items. Solid tires, on the other hand, offer an easier ride and are puncture-proof making them an excellent option for terrains that are rough. They also require less maintenance than air tires and are more durable.
It is essential to match the tread pattern and size of the tires originally purchased when selecting the tires for a scooter to ensure compatibility and long-lasting. It is also important to examine the tires frequently for signs of wear and tear or damage. Make sure you fix any issues you find as soon as possible. This will extend the life span of your mobility scooter and improve the overall performance of your mobility scooter.
Mobility scooter tires are available in a wide range of sizes and tread patterns. You can select the one that best suits your requirements. You can choose one with ribbed tread, which is more durable and provides more grip. You can also choose between a foam-filled or a solid tire for your scooter, based on the terrain that you navigate. A solid tire does not require air, but is heavier and may require two-piece rims.
High Ground Clearance
When you are looking for a mobility scooter, one of the most important features to consider is its ground clearance. This is the distance from the base of your scooter to the ground which is usually measured from the platform where you put your feet. It is also not unusual for manufacturers to measure this distance from other parts of the scooter, such as the motor. A mobility scooter with a high ground clearance is able to handle many different terrains including rough roads.
It is crucial to have enough ground clearance when riding a scooter over grassy terrain. If you don't have enough clearance, your scooter can be snagged or scratch its undercarriage. This can cause damage to the scooter, resulting in an uncomfortable ride. If you wish to avoid this, buy a model with an increased ground clearance or suspension systems.
In addition to having a good ground clearance, it's crucial to choose the right scooter with a stable base. This will stop the scooter from tipping over, which could be dangerous for the rider. The base of the scooter must be made of a material that is resistant to humidity, temperature fluctuations and harsh weather conditions.

Long battery life
Long battery life on 4-wheel mobility scooters scoots give their owners peace of mind and allows them to explore more of the world without worrying about power shortages. However, the life span of batteries for mobility scooters depends on many aspects, including their type and capacity. Furthermore, the frequency and how heavily the scooter is used and its charging procedures play an important part in the lifespan of the battery.
It is recommended that you follow the instructions of the manufacturer for charging to extend the life of your battery. Avoid letting batteries deplete to 0% before charging, and ensure that they are fully recharged between use. It is important to use the right battery charger. A charger that has a wrong voltage rating could harm the electrical system of a scooter.
The weight capacity of the scooter along with the terrain and your habits of use can all affect the battery's performance. Regular riding and lengthy trips reduce battery capacity faster than shorter, more frequent trips. Additionally, climbing up hilly or steep inclines demands more energy, which dries out the battery's capacity more quickly. Keeping the scooter's tires properly inflated helps preserve battery life as well.
Batteries can be upgraded to modern technology, like lithium ion batteries which offer more runtime per charge and a longer lifespan than lead-acid batteries. It is also essential to select the correct battery to match the power needs of the scooter's motor and controllers to increase performance and extend the life of. It is also essential to keep the scooter's battery away from direct sunlight and extreme temperatures to prevent damage and premature failure. Lastly, regular maintenance, for example, inspecting and cleaning the battery's terminals, will prevent excessive drain. This is a simple but efficient method to boost battery performance and extend its life.
